Title: Special Olympics 2008 Summer Games
Date: 5/31/2008
Time:
Organization: Special Olympics Vermont
Description: Special Olympics Vermont will host the 39th Annual Summer Games at UVM. One hundred coaches and more than 200 volunteers will provide support throughout the entire weekend to ensure a successful event. The games will include Unified Sports teams which comprise individuals with and without intellectual disabilities on the same team. Spectators are welcomed and encouraged to support all Special Olympic Vermont athletes.
Cost:
Contact: Cindy Elcan, 1-800-639-1603, ext. 109
Where: University of Vermont, Burlington

Title: The Awareness Theater Company Presents "...And Justice For All"
Date: 5/27/2008
Time: 2 pm
Organization: Lost Nation Theater
Description: This is a unique performance based upon the real experiences of teens and people with disabilities in Vermont. The theater is wheelchair accessible and ASL interpretation will be provided.
Cost: Free
Contact: 1-800-750-1213
Where: City Hall, Montpelier


Title: Cheer on KeyBank Vermont City Marathon Participants
Date: 5/25/2008
Time: 8 am
Organization: Northeast Disabled Athletic Association
Description: A record number of "wheeled" competitors will be lining up to race in the 20th anniversary marathon. Fifteen competitors will be trying to finish the 26.2-mile course in handcycles and push-rim wheelchairs. Come out and support the racers in this great event.
Cost:
Contact: Patrick Standen, 862-6322
Where: The marathon starts at Battery Park, wends its way throughout the city and ends in the beautiful waterfront park.
